5 Steps to a Stress-Free Veterinary Exam



Proper preparation helps eliminate anxiety, creates a smooth consultation, and ensures your doctor gets all necessary medical information.




Practical Checklist for Your Pet's Appointment



  1. Gather Medical Records and History: Collect past vaccination records, current medication names and dosages, and notes on recent behavioral or appetite changes.

  2. Write Down Your Concerns: Discussing subtle daily changes helps identify early indicators of underlying health concerns.

  3. Acclimatize Your Pet to Travel: Acclimating your pet to their carrier with treats and familiar blankets reduces travel anxiety significantly.

  4. Maintain a Calm Demeanor: Soothing verbal praise and gentle touch reassure your companion throughout the clinical process.

  5. Implement Recommended Care Protocols: Administer prescribed medications exactly as directed and observe your pet during their recovery period.
